Middle East and Africa Fleet Management Market Insights:

Segments

- By Vehicle Type: Commercial Vehicles, Private Vehicles
- By Component: Solution, Services
- By Deployment Type: On-Premises, Cloud

Fleet management in the Middle East and Africa region is witnessing significant growth, driven by the increasing demand for efficient and cost-effective transportation services. The market can be segmented based on vehicle type, component, and deployment type. In terms of vehicle type, the market caters to both commercial and private vehicles, with a growing emphasis on optimizing operations for commercial fleets to enhance productivity and reduce operational costs. The component segment comprises solutions and services, with a rising adoption of advanced fleet management solutions such as telematics, GPS tracking, and predictive maintenance to streamline operations and improve overall efficiency. Additionally, the deployment type segment includes both on-premises and cloud-based solutions, offering flexibility and scalability to fleet operators in the region.

One emerging trend in the Middle East and Africa fleet management market is the increasing integration of Internet of Things (IoT) technology to enable real-time monitoring, remote diagnostics, and data analytics for enhanced fleet performance. IoT-enabled solutions can provide valuable insights into vehicle health, driver behavior, fuel consumption, and route optimization, enabling fleet managers to make informed decisions and improve overall operational efficiency. As connectivity and data become more prevalent in the fleet management landscape, companies are expected to invest in IoT platforms and devices to achieve greater visibility and control over their fleets.

Another key development in the market is the growing demand for sustainability and environmental consciousness in fleet operations. With increasing regulatory pressure and consumer awareness around carbon emissions and environmental impact, fleet operators are looking for ways to reduce their carbon footprint and adopt eco-friendly practices. This shift towards sustainability is driving the adoption of electric vehicles, alternative fuels, and fuel-efficient technologies in the region's fleets, creating opportunities for companies that offer green fleet management solutions and consultancy services.
